1. What is your role at MBH? What does that look like day to day?
I serve as the Director of Nursing at MBH, where I oversee all aspects of our medical and nursing operations. In my role, I supervise and support our nursing staff, ensuring they have the guidance and resources needed to provide high-quality care. On a day-to-day basis, I make sure client medications are properly ordered, managed, and administered safely and accurately. I also complete client assessments to monitor health needs and adjust care as necessary. Overall, my focus is on keeping our medical services running smoothly each day, maintaining high standards of care, and ensuring the well-being of every client we serve.

2. What is your background? What degrees do you have and which universities did you attend?
My professional journey began in advertising and marketing after earning my first Bachelor’s degree in English and Communication Studies from Florida Atlantic University. After three years in the field, I realized my true passion was in healthcare and chose to pursue a career in nursing. I completed an accelerated nursing program at Thomas Jefferson University, where I earned my BSN.

Since then, I have gained experience across several specialties, including adult medical-surgical nursing, outpatient occupational health, and most recently, working in a Level IV NICU at Children’s Hospital of Philadelphia.
